Output e607aee922615f7da7e9a94ff8804c5fd5396424595a93767d8c65c66bf100ce:18

value
53001
script pubkey
OP_0 OP_PUSHBYTES_20 625523aee6ea6fe899215bfc043fbdc6b43aed4e
address
bc1qvf2j8thxafh73xfpt07qg0aac66r4m2wt3hf7f
transaction
e607aee922615f7da7e9a94ff8804c5fd5396424595a93767d8c65c66bf100ce
confirmations
45492
spent
true